The foundation of a successful import project is thorough supplier verification. The term “mold maker” in China encompasses a vast range of capabilities, from small workshops to fully integrated engineering firms. Begin your search with a focus on technical competence rather than price alone. Scrutinize the supplier’s portfolio for projects similar in complexity, material, and industry to yours. Request detailed case studies and, crucially, contact past international clients for references. A professional China mold factory will readily provide this information. Verify their business licenses and export history. During initial discussions, pay close attention to their communication style and technical questioning; a reliable partner will probe deeply into your part design, material selection, and production volume to understand your needs fully, rather than immediately quoting a price.
Once a potential partner is identified, implementing a rigorous pre-production quality control protocol is non-negotiable. Clear and detailed technical documentation is your first line of defense. Your Request for Quotation should include not just 3D drawings, but also a comprehensive specification sheet covering the part material, expected annual volume, cosmetic requirements, tolerance standards, and desired mold life. This document becomes the binding technical agreement. Insist on a formal Design for Manufacturability review before any steel is cut. A competent supplier will analyze your part design and suggest modifications to improve moldability, reduce cost, and enhance durability. Furthermore, define the mold approval process upfront. This should include the submission of 3D mold flow analysis reports, 2D mold structure drawings for your approval, and a schedule for critical design review meetings.
Managing the production and sampling phase with transparency is key to avoiding costly surprises. Establish a milestone-based payment schedule linked to clear deliverables, such as 30% upon order, 40% after mold assembly, and 30% after sample approval. This aligns interests and maintains cash flow leverage. The most critical step is the Trial Sample Report. Do not accept a simple shipment of samples. Demand a detailed report including photos of the finished mold, sample part measurements against the CAD data, process parameters used during trial, and a first-article inspection report. For high-value or complex projects, hiring a local third-party quality inspection agency to witness the sample trial and inspect the mold before shipment is a highly recommended investment. This on-ground verification provides an objective assessment of workmanship and part quality.
Finalizing the project requires attention to logistics, intellectual property, and after-sales support. Ensure the commercial invoice and shipping documents accurately describe the goods as “Injection Mold” or “Mold Base” with the correct Harmonized System code to avoid customs delays. Discuss packaging; molds should be crated in a waterproof, shock-absorbent wooden case for ocean freight. Regarding intellectual property, a well-drafted Non-Disclosure Agreement is essential, but for ultimate protection, consider registering your design patents in China. Finally, clarify the terms of after-sales service. What is the warranty period for the mold? How are repair costs handled for premature wear? Will the supplier provide maintenance instructions and spare part lists? A reliable partner will stand behind their work and support the mold’s lifecycle.
